Summary:
"Emma has always been "the practical one" in the family. But that is about to change as she embarks on the adventure of her life. Emma Davis wants a new life now that she no longer needs to care for her grandmother. A spur-of-the-moment visit to a travel agency sets her on a journey far from her Iowa home. Emma takes a cruise to the far islands of the Pacific, but it isn't until she arrives in Papua, New Guinea, that she begins to realize her true calling. Emma regains her sense of purpose by caring for three motherless children and befriending their father, Josh Daniels. Josh's troubled past and the loss of his wife have left him vulnerable, but can the love Emma has discovered in her own heart, awaken his heart to all Emma has to offer?" Provided by publisher.
